What is Maryland Historical Trust addendum?
The Maryland Historical Trust addendum is a supplementary form required by the Maryland Historical Trust that provides additional information regarding properties listed or eligible for listing on the Maryland Register of Historic Properties.
Who is required to file Maryland Historical Trust addendum?
Typically, property owners, developers, or entities involved in projects that affect historic properties are required to file the Maryland Historical Trust addendum as part of their compliance with state preservation laws.
How to fill out Maryland Historical Trust addendum?
To fill out the Maryland Historical Trust addendum, one must provide detailed information about the property, including its history, significance, and any proposed changes. Specific instructions and a checklist are usually provided with the addendum form.
What is the purpose of Maryland Historical Trust addendum?
The purpose of the Maryland Historical Trust addendum is to ensure that all relevant information about a historic property is disclosed, allowing the Trust to assess the impact of proposed projects on historical resources.
What information must be reported on Maryland Historical Trust addendum?
The addendum generally requires reporting information such as property description, historical significance, any existing conditions, and impacts of proposed changes or developments on the historic property.
